> i decided to put some more url 's into my download.ini (webinfo's) so i
> get 7782 servers to connect ,BUT i cannot connect anymore to a server
> for hours edonkey is trying to connect but no succes at all.

I guess, 97% of those servers listed are dead, because they run on a
dynamic IP. Each connection try takes about 5 seconds. Now, to scan
those 7500 dead servers, it takes 7500*5/3600 = about 10 hours.

> so should i get rid of those extra url's ???  

Definatetly. It only hurts your search for open servers and new sources.
